Instructions

  1. Rinse lentils and cook them with 3 cups of water until soft and mushy (about 20 minutes).
  2. Cook basmati rice separately with 2 cups of water until tender.
  3. Heat ghee in a small pan and add cumin seeds. Let them sizzle.
  4. Add chopped garlic and sauté until golden. Add tomatoes and cook for 5 minutes.
  5. Pour the tadka (tempering) over the cooked lentils and stir gently.
  6. Season with salt and serve hot over rice.
